const{Parser}=require('node-sql-parser');constparser=newParser();constsql='UPDATE a SET id = 1 WHERE name IN (SELECT name FROM b)'constwhiteTableList=['(select|update)::(.*)::(a|b)']// array that contain multiple authoritiesconstopt={database:'MySQL',type:'table',}// opt is ...
### 关键词 Node-sqlserver, SQL Server, Node.js, 数据库访问, 代码示例 ## 一、Node-sqlserver简介与安装配置 ### 1.1 Node-sqlserver概述 在当今这个数据驱动的时代,数据库技术的重要性不言而喻。作为一款由微软官方推出的SQL Server驱动程序,Node-sqlserver为Node.js开发者们提供了一个强大的工具箱,让...
在NodeJs中如何防止SQL模糊查询导致的SQL注入? 最近在改一个比较久的项目,是使用nodejs写的,但是对于长期写java的后端开发来说,还是有点难维护,不过不改bug的话,就需要重新开发,所以只能慢慢看nodejs代码,测试人员提了一个需要支持模糊查询的bug,如果是java写的,可以马上改好,因为不熟悉nodejs代码,还是改了一两...
Node.js 是一个基于 Chrome V8 引擎的 JavaScript 运行时环境,允许开发者使用 JavaScript 编写服务器端的应用程序。SQL(Structured Query Language)是一种用于管理关系数据库的语言,用于执行查询、插入、更新和删除数据等操作。 复杂的 Insert 与 SQL 函数 在Node.js 中执行复杂的 SQL 插入操作通常涉及以下几个方...
constsql=require('msnodesqlv8')constpool=newsql.Pool({connectionString:'Driver={ODBC Driver 13 for SQL Server};Server=(localdb)\\node;Database=scratch;Trusted_Connection=yes;'})pool.on('open',(options)=>{console.log(`ready options =${JSON.stringify(options,null,4)}`)})pool.on('debug'...
node-mssql/lib/global-connection.jsgithub.com/tediousjs/node-mssql/blob/master/lib/global-connection.js 有争议的部分,如下截图: 可以看见,这个 globalConnection 就是元凶。当你已经有一个全局连接实例,他就会不会去创建新的连接实例了。 似乎也有用户对连接实例提出了争议:Feature Request: acquire single...
Node.js 适用于 SQL Server 的 Node.js 驱动程序 步骤1:配置开发环境 步骤2:创建 SQL 数据库 步骤3:连接到 SQL 的概念验证 ODBC OLE DB PHP Python 红宝石 火花 ADO 下载PDF 使用英语阅读 通过 Facebookx.com 共享LinkedIn电子邮件 打印 步骤3:使用 Node.js 连接到 SQL 的概念证明 ...
NoSQLBooster设置连接多节点 使用node连接数据库 以下我们将说明node连接数据库的三种方式,并进行利弊说明,以挑选出最适合项目的连接方式。 1.使用mysql包的提供的接口进行连接 例如: connection.query('SELECT * FROM users WHERE id = ?', ['123'], function(err, rows) {...
$ npm install --save node-sqlizer API API Doc Example letquery={ table:'test', where:{ key1:'value1', key2:{ $or:{ $neq:'value2', $in:[2,3,4], }, }, key3:{ $like:'%test%', }, }, limit:[10,20], orderBy:'key1 DESC', ...
nodejs 访问msql yarn global add tedious yarn global add sequelize sequelize反向工程 yarn global add sequelize-auto 编写生成脚本 #!/bin/bash HOST="10.10.1.10" DB="" USER="" PASS="" PORT="1433" DIR="./dao/all" #JSON_DEFINED="./dao/json" ...